How to prepare for a job interview at Frank Wills Recruitment
✨Know Your Contracts
Before the interview, brush up on your knowledge of contract law and common clauses. Being able to discuss specific examples or even recent changes in legislation can really impress the interviewers and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
Since strong written and verbal communication skills are key for this position, prepare to demonstrate these during the interview. Practice explaining complex legal concepts in simple terms, as you might need to do this when supporting clients or collaborating with other departments.
✨Organise Your Thoughts
With the emphasis on managing workloads and adhering to deadlines, it’s crucial to show how you prioritise tasks. Think of examples from your studies or any work experience where you successfully managed multiple responsibilities and be ready to share them.
✨Build Rapport
This role involves building strong relationships both internally and externally. During the interview, try to connect with your interviewers by asking insightful questions about the team dynamics and how they collaborate. This shows that you’re not just interested in the job, but also in being a part of their team.
